What’s Cooking This Season?

This season is bubbling with promise, as many of these athletes are poised for breakout performances. Coaches from local high schools have been voicing their expectations, shedding light on what fans can look forward to in the upcoming matches.

For instance, Battle Creek Central, under Coach Mel Carrillo, aims to improve upon their 5-12-1 record last year. Over at Coldwater, Coach Ken Delaney is optimistic after a solid 15-7-1 season last year, finishing second in their conference. Meanwhile, both Gull Lake and Lakeview are strategizing ways to bounce back from challenging past seasons.

The champions, Harper Creek, led by Coach Kyle Grestini, are looking to defend their title, bringing back some key starters to reinforce their team. Marshall, under Coach Hans Morgan, dazzled last year as the Interstate 8 Conference champions with a record of 8-8-2. Their tenacity will be hard to ignore! Pennfield, who aims to turn around their previous 3-17-1 record, and Calhoun Christian/St. Philip co-op, which had an impressive 8-4-1 record, are also on a mission this season.

Mark Your Calendars for Upcoming Events!

Excitement builds as we approach key dates in the season. Don’t miss the All-City Boys Soccer Tournament starting on August 22, 2025. And for those looking ahead, the district tournament kicks off on October 8, 2025, leading up to the highly anticipated MHSAA state finals on November 1, 2025, taking place at Grand Ledge High School.
